Life is a highway.. and the highway from South LA to SoCal..is LONG

I recently drove across the country for the 3rd time... I packed up the Stang, said farewell to Nola (and my folks) and hit the road for Southern California. To say that the drive is long is a severe understatement. Especially in the summer, it's hot out west, and my poor car (and my poor aunt who accompanied me on the drive) are still feeling the effects from the 3 days we spent traveling in 100 degree heat.

Just FYI- west Texas is beautiful. I had no idea peaches and wine were big in west Texas..but apparently-they are. All I remembered of west Texas from my previous two treks was that it was desolate and deserted.. but this time I actually notice so many things I hadn't before. It's hilly, and very lush before you hit the desert part of it. Rolling hills and vineyards.. It was awesome. Being out on the open road gave me plenty of time to think, and it made me feel lucky to believe (despite the heat, no sleep, the driving, the crazy buzzard, and the mass quantities of junk food I consumed..)

Arizona and New Mexico are beautiful too, but in a much different way. Being a Louisiana girl, I don't get to see too many mountains. This trip, I saw tons. Beautiful mesas and peaks.. Just stunning. It was very peaceful.. until I whacked a buzzard with my car going 70mph...

Yep.. I'm pretty sure he's dead... :/

The pic above is actually the 170 in Cali, but the pics below are from Texas and Arizona. These were all taken with my iPhone 4.
